Director, Corporate Partnerships
The National Multiple Sclerosis Society mobilizes people and resources to drive research for a cure and to address the challenges of everyone affected by MS. To fulfill this mission, the Society funds cutting-edge research, drives change through advocacy, facilitates professional education, collaborates with MS organizations around the world, and provides programs and services designed to help people with MS and their families move their lives forward. We partner with volunteers to accomplish our work. Staff members engage volunteers through effective and timely communications, facilitating meaningful opportunities, and continually seeking and providing feedback for reciprocal growth and learning.
The Director, Corporate Partnerships, is responsible for developing and managing national corporate partnerships in a regional structure to support revenue goals and the expansion of national sponsorships and cause marketing campaigns. Reporting to the Assistant Vice President, Corporate Partnerships, this role serves as a key relationship manager for regional corporate prospects and partners, working collaboratively with local teams and regional staff to drive engagement, secure sponsorships, and build long-term, mission-aligned partnerships. The Director plays a central role in implementing the national strategy at the regional level while identifying new opportunities for corporate engagement and revenue growth.
This is a market-based role supporting our Southeast and Southwest Regions. As a market-based employee, you will spend up to 30% of your work time in the community cultivating relationships, attending events, and supporting local initiatives. The role includes limited travel throughout the assigned market and region, as well as occasional overnight travel for regional and enterprise meetings, trainings, and events.

Main Responsibilities:
- Support the AVP, Corporate Partnerships to create and execute a national corporate partnerships strategy and evaluate value proposition focused on growing non-industry related revenue and cause marketing efforts.
- Cultivate and manage a portfolio of regional corporate partners and prospects, cultivating and stewarding relationships to maximize revenue and engagement.
- Support the implementation of the national corporate partnership and cause marketing strategies across assigned regions.
- Identify, cultivate, and solicit new corporate prospects in collaboration with regional development teams, leadership volunteers, and the Assistant Director, Corporate Partnerships operating on a local level.
- Design and deliver tailored sponsorship packages and engagement opportunities that align with corporate partner objectives and organizational priorities.
- Partner with internal key stakeholders to develop integrated proposals and ensure seamless execution.
- Track and report on partnership activity, revenue, and pipeline using CRM systems and other tools to inform strategy and performance management.
- Collaborate with regional and national colleagues to share insights, align priorities, and strengthen partner engagement across Chapters.
- Represent the organization at regional events, meetings, and presentations to advance relationships and raise visibility.
- Ensure high-quality stewardship and recognition plans are in place for all corporate partners, driving retention and long-term value.
- Stay informed on corporate social responsibility (CSR) trends, regional market dynamics, and emerging partnership opportunities.
- At this career level, you are leading by helping your peers understand a subject area.
What We're Looking for:
- 8 years of demonstrated and relevant fundraising experience with advanced understanding of prospect qualification, cultivation, solicitation, and stewardship.
- Record of accomplishment in fundraising including campaign planning and execution, pipeline development, and mid-level revenue generation across multiple markets.
- Able to partner with staff toward a shared vision, providing strategic guidance to ensure staff meet their designated revenue and activity goals.
- Proven ability to manage broad and technical fundraising campaigns, collaborating effectively with staff and volunteers to secure individual gifts.
- Demonstrated success in coaching staff to higher levels of gift closure and performance and guiding leadership staff through portfolio management, holding reporting and nonreporting staff accountable to identified revenue and donor targets.
- Proven nonprofit leadership experience with increasing responsibility, successfully driving 7-8 figure partnerships
- Expertise in AI, predictive analytics, and CRM tools to optimize sales pipeline automation, donor journey mapping, and forecasting donor trends to enhance retention and maximize event success.
- Track record of implementing innovative fundraising strategies that drive engagement and revenue growth.
- Strong ability to perform under pressure, handle criticism professionally, and consistently meet fundraising commitments.
- Exceptional project management, strategic planning, and negotiation skills to drive effective resource allocation and optimize fundraising outcomes.
- Advanced CRM expertise, leveraging data analytics to drive decision-making and train teams on data-driven fundraising strategies.
- Field-based role requiring 30%+ travel, including events, training, regional meetings, and organizational gatherings.
